In Cerritos and the broader Los Angeles and Orange County region, the monthly cost for a private, one-bedroom apartment in an assisted living community typically ranges from approximately $4,500 to over $7,000. This wide range reflects differences in the community itself, the specific care plan required, and the amenities offered. It’s important to understand that this base fee usually covers essentials like housing, utilities, meals, housekeeping, transportation for appointments, and a core set of personal care services. Many families are initially surprised by the figure, but it’s helpful to compare it to the combined costs of maintaining a home, groceries, utilities, property taxes, and in-home care, which can quickly add up to a comparable amount, especially in our area.
The single most significant factor influencing cost is the level of care your loved one needs. Communities conduct assessments to create a personalized care plan. Assistance with medication management, bathing, dressing, or mobility support will often be itemized and added to the base rate. A resident who is largely independent but values the social community and safety will have a different cost structure than someone requiring more hands-on, daily assistance. When touring communities in Cerritos, be sure to ask for a detailed, written breakdown of what is included in the quoted price and how additional care services are billed. Transparency here is crucial for accurate budgeting.
Beyond care levels, the community’s location, age, and amenities play a role. A newer community with extensive grounds, a full-time activity director, a salon, or a specialized memory care wing may command a higher price. However, many wonderful, well-established communities in our area offer exceptional care and a warm atmosphere at a more moderate cost. Consider what amenities are truly valuable to your loved one’s happiness. Financing this care is a common concern. While Medicare does not cover long-term assisted living, veterans and surviving spouses may be eligible for Aid and Attendance benefits. Long-term care insurance, if your family has a policy, is designed specifically for this purpose. Some families use proceeds from the sale of a home, savings, or a combination of resources. It can be immensely helpful to consult with a financial advisor or an elder law attorney who understands California’s specific regulations and options. Remember, you are not alone in this.
